Having a colicky baby can feel overwhelming and exhausting at times, but with time, most babies outgrow their colicky tendencies. If your baby is fussy a great deal of the time, it's normal to look for solutions to ease their discomfort, especially if your doctor has ruled out larger issues like food allergies and acid reflux. If you're considering giving your baby gripe water, talk to your doctor about how to best use it and watch your baby for any potential side effects.

Also, be careful not to use gripe water in place of a feeding. Doing so could cause your baby to miss out on important nutrients they need to grow and develop. In the meantime, make sure you give yourself adequate breaks and that you engage in self care.

Some parents notice that their babies become sleepy after administering gripe water. The reason is that babies who do not feel well due to colic, extreme discomfort, or gas are often tired due to tension.

Once the babies were given gripe water, they feel better and relieved that they fell asleep. Some parents find it challenging to administer gripe water to their babies.

Mothers may put the right amount of gripe water inside the empty baby bottle to make it easy for them to drink the gripe water. However, grip water, when diluted, makes it less effective. Certain herbs may be used as a substitute to gripe water. Research proved that fennel seed oil, when given to babies, notably relieves colic behavior, especially when the baby is crying because of gastrointestinal discomfort.

This discomfort often leads to babies crying for extended periods of time, as they cannot relieve themselves of the pressure from gas buildup. This internal discomfort can be caused by several factors, colic, for example. If your infant is crying for at least three hours a day three or more times a week, he or she might have colic.
